# Market Commentary: Tech Strength and Geopolitical Considerations
On May 22, 2026, major U.S. equity indices moved higher during the trading session, with technology stocks contributing meaningfully to the day's gains. The broader market environment reflected investor appetite for growth-oriented equities, while participants also kept attention on diplomatic developments between the United States and Iran. This combination of domestic market momentum and international developments created a backdrop worth understanding for anyone tracking market dynamics.
Technology companies and related sectors experienced notable strength during this session. When tech stocks advance, the impact typically extends beyond the sector itself—semiconductor suppliers, software service providers, and companies dependent on digital infrastructure often move in tandem. Additionally, sectors sensitive to interest rate expectations, such as consumer discretionary and communications, may respond to the same underlying factors driving technology performance. Understanding these interconnections helps explain how a move in one area can ripple across the broader market.
Geopolitical developments, particularly those involving major oil-producing regions, warrant monitoring by market participants. Diplomatic discussions between significant powers can influence energy prices, which in turn affect transportation costs, manufacturing expenses, and inflation expectations across the economy. Financial markets have historically shown sensitivity to shifts in international relations, especially when they touch on energy supply or trade relationships. Investors often adjust their positioning based on how they assess the likelihood and potential outcomes of such negotiations.
